What is out biggest fear when it comes to retirement?
Well, according to a new survey from the Indexed Annuity Leadership Council, our biggest fear is running out of money. Twenty-five percent of Americans are worried about that. And it’s not the first survey to show that trend.
“I think when you look at the top fears of people and what’s on their minds, and 25 percent of Americans are concerned about outliving their retirement, the immediate reaction is a lot of people aren’t thinking about that or don’t want to because they haven’t’ looked at what their future holds,” says Jim Poolman, executive director of the council.
